Notes
HR: YOM: Sakamoto (7, none on, off Shinoda), Chono (8, one on, off Shinoda).
Yomiuri: Gonzalez started his first game since April 16 (vs Chunichi) and got the win. He is 2-0 in four starts. ... Nishimura saved his fifteenth game of the year. ... The Giants stopped a four-game losing streak at Mazda Stadium.
Hiroshima: Shinoda dropped his third straight start and is now 1-3 in six games (all four decisions came in his four starts). This was his first start/game since May 1 (vs Yomiuri). ... Iwamoto extended his hitting streak to fifteen games; Amaya extended his to sixteen games. ... Every position player in the starting line-up collected at least one hit.
